Hospital staffers helping ‘Santa’

THE GOSHEN NEWS

LAGRANGE, Ind. — Parkview LaGrange Hospital employees are partnering with “Santa Claus” to support the LaGrange Clothes and Food Basket’s Christmas Bureau this year.

The hospital’s Employee Fun Squad has spearheaded the drive, encouraging co-workers to help fill Santa’s bag with canned goods, paper products, toys and more.

“Members of the community who may be in the neighborhood are welcome to drop things off with Santa or stop by the gift shop to buy a paper ornament,” said Michael Charlier, chairman of the Employee Fun Squad. “We know the needs in the community are especially great this year. Every donation, no matter how small, will enable the Clothes and Food Basket to help someone in need.”

In addition to collecting food and toys, the Fun Squad is also selling paper ornaments through the gift shop and cafeteria to decorate a Christmas tree outside the cafeteria. Ornaments are sold for donations of $1 or more. All monies raised through ornament sales will be given to the Clothes and Food Basket to help purchase items of greatest need.

Parkview LaGrange emergency department staff have taken the drive one step further by challenging other hospital departments to collect as many new and gently used coats as they can.

The emergency room nurses will buy ice cream for all the employees of the department that donates the greatest number of coats per staff member.

Helping to support the nurses in their coat drive challenge are Price’s Laundry in LaGrange and Ludder’s Cleaners in Sturgis, Mich., both of which are donating their services to clean all of the gently used coats that are collected.
